From the history of Lithuanian picture books (1900-1930)
The present article is concerned with Lithuanian picture books from the period 1900 to 1930. A new term paveikslėlių knyga to specify this children's book genre has been introduced, which was not in wide use in Lithuanian book research before.

Early Sámi visual artists - Western fine art meets Sámi culture [PDF]
Johan Turi (1854–1936), Nils Nilsson Skum (1872–1951) and John Savio (1902–1938) were among the first Sámi visual artists. The production of their art work occurred between the 1910s and the early 1950s.
